L7 presents new CITADELE training system for military training of young people

Logics7 has released CITADELE, a modern laser shooting simulator for education and military training of young people. The system is designed to practice shooting techniques without the use of ammunition and is already available for use in secondary schools as part of the Defence of Ukraine subject.

CITADELE allows you to simulate realistic shooting conditions, including time of day, weather conditions and different types of targets. It will help young people learn basic firearms skills and prepare for the defence of Ukraine.
